Simple Machines

        Help!  

force   exerting pressure over object or substance  
🗑
friction   the act f a surface or an object rubbing against each other  
🗑
fulcrum   the support on which a lever turns or is helped in moving or lifting something  
🗑
inclined plane   a plank or plane surface put at an angle to a horizontal surface  
🗑
lever   a bar which rests on a fulcrum  
🗑
load   amount of work a machine is expected to perform  
🗑
machine   any device that applies or changes the direction of power, force, or motion  
🗑
axle   bar on which a wheel turns  
🗑
power   strength of force that can be exerted on other bodies  
🗑
pull   to move, usually with force or effort  
🗑
pulley   a wheel that has a groove in the rim where a rope can run and change the direction the pull  
🗑
push   to move something away by pressing against it  
🗑
screw   cylinder with a ridge winding around it. Its a simple machine  
🗑
spring   something that produces action, a moving force  
🗑
tool   an instrument of work  
🗑
torque   a force that causes rotation  
🗑
wedge   to force an openning  
🗑
wheel   a round frame that turns on a pin or shaft in its middle  
🗑
work   an effort in doing or making something
